A common issue players face when booting up a Pokémon LeafGreen ROM is a white screen or a "Save file error" warning. To fix this, you must configure your emulator's save settings: Set the to Flash . Set the Flash Size to 128 KB .

A ROM (Read-Only Memory) file is a digital copy of a video game cartridge's data, allowing it to be played on modern devices via emulation. The "V1.0" designation refers to the initial retail software version launched in North America and other English-speaking territories.

Released in 2004, (along with FireRed) marked a monumental moment for the franchise: the very first remakes. As a reimagining of the original Pokémon Green (Japan) and Blue (International), LeafGreen brought the Kanto region to the Game Boy Advance with updated graphics, enhanced mechanics, and modern amenities.
